Biography of L'Oreal Commercial Actresses

When it comes to L'Oreal, the actresses who represent the brand often have remarkable stories that resonate with many. Below, we highlight a few prominent figures.

1. Eva Longoria

Eva Longoria is not just a talented actress; she is a philanthropist and entrepreneur. Known for her role in the television series "Desperate Housewives," Longoria became the face of L'Oreal in the early 2000s. Her advocacy for Hispanic rights and her work in the community have made her an influential figure beyond the screen.

2. Helen Mirren

Helen Mirren, an Academy Award-winning actress, became the face of L'Oreal in 2014. Her involvement with the brand broke stereotypes about aging in the beauty industry, promoting the idea that beauty knows no age.

3. Aishwarya Rai Bachchan

Aishwarya Rai Bachchan, an internationally recognized actress from India, has been a L'Oreal ambassador since 2003. Her work has brought attention to the brand in Asian markets, showcasing the importance of cultural representation in global campaigns.

4. Viola Davis

Viola Davis, the first African American actress to win an Emmy Award for Outstanding Lead Actress in a Drama Series, represents L'Oreal's commitment to diversity and empowerment in the beauty industry. Her powerful presence has redefined beauty standards.

Notable Actresses in L'Oreal Commercials

Several actresses have made significant contributions to L'Oreal's advertising campaigns. Here are some notable figures:

1. Kate Winslet

Kate Winslet has been a L'Oreal ambassador since 2007, and her partnership has emphasized the brand's commitment to natural beauty.

2. Jennifer Aniston

Jennifer Aniston, known for her timeless beauty, has represented L'Oreal since 2013, promoting the brand's hair care line.

3. Cheryl Cole

Cheryl Cole's involvement with L'Oreal has significantly impacted the brand's image in the UK, showcasing the power of celebrity endorsements.
